Though they're often lumped in with other 1970s prog-rock groups, Jethro Tull was always a band apart. Very Best of Jethro Tull songs With their British folk leanings, they had a foot in the UK folk-rock camp a la Fairport Convention, and their knack for trenchant guitar riffs endeared them to the Led Zeppelin-loving heavy-rock crowd as well. THE VERY BEST OF JETHRO TULL touches on all the aspects of the group's sound, drawing liberally from every era of their career.
